Analyst coverage of Moody’s Corporation has recently featured a range of views, with several firms maintaining a positive stance on the stock. Moody’s, a leading provider of credit ratings, research, and risk analysis, benefits from its entrenched role in global debt markets. Some analysts note that the company’s diversified revenue streams, including financial data and analytics, could support steady growth even amid economic uncertainty. On the other hand, a few analysts have adopted a more cautious tone, citing potential risks such as a slowdown in debt issuance activity and rising interest rates, which may pressure Moody’s ratings business. The stock’s current valuation, trading at a premium to historical averages, has also prompted some to question whether upside potential is fully priced in. According to market data, Moody’s shares have performed in line with broader financial sector trends over recent months. The latest available earnings report from Moody’s showed revenue growth driven by strong demand for analytics and risk management solutions. However, management’s forward guidance included cautious remarks about the macroeconomic environment, which may have influenced analyst revisions.

Key takeaways from the analyst sentiment on Moody’s include a general recognition of the company’s competitive moat in credit ratings and its expanding analytics business. The company’s ability to generate recurring revenue from subscription-based services is seen as a positive factor that could provide stability. However, analyst estimates suggest that Moody’s earnings growth might moderate if global debt market activity slows. The firm’s sensitivity to economic cycles and regulatory changes remains a point of discussion. Market observers also point to potential headwinds from increased competition in the data analytics space, although Moody’s brand and established client relationships may help mitigate this. The range of analyst price targets for Moody’s indicates a mix of upside and downside expectations, reflecting the uncertainty in the current market environment.
